I applied online. The process took 4 days. I interviewed at American Diabetes Association
Interview
After submitting my resume, I had one interview. The office was friendly as was the interviewer. The interview was fairly informal and they did not seem prepared for the position. It felt like they were told to have the position and did not actually want anyone for it. The interviewer actually walked out of the interview for a moment to talk to a coworker. I was hired at the end of the position and was called later that week to start on a project.
